North Paw: Vibro Compass Anklet From: Maker Faire Inspired by the feelSpace belt from Germany, the North Paw is worn on the ankle and provides the user a persistent sense of the direction of North. There are eight vibrating motors; the one on North side of your ankle will be on. What makes it way more more awesome than a regular compass? Persistence. With a regular compass, the owner only knows the direction when he or she checks it. With this compass, the information enters the wearer's brain at a subconscious level, giving the wearer a true feeling of absolute direction, rather than an intellectual knowledge as with a regular compass. Because of the plasticity of the brain, it has been shown that most wearers gain a new sense of absolute direction, giving them a superhuman ability to navigate their surroundings.
